Latest Patents
Among Wheelock's recent patents is a groundbreaking invention involving an in vitro screening assay designed for the identification of compounds that can inhibit viral infections, particularly those caused by the human immunodeficiency virus (HIV-1). This inventive method relies on the ligand binding of the Ah receptor, eliminating the need for transformation, translocation, and DNA binding of the receptor. By studying compounds that either act as agonists or antagonists to the Ah receptor, Wheelock has successfully identified therapeutic candidates that interrupt viral pathogenic signaling pathways. Notably, his findings underscore the therapeutic potential of antagonists due to their low toxicity levels and reduced likelihood of resistance through genetic mutation.
Another notable patent addresses the detection of dioxin-like compounds. This method involves the use of an inactive Ah receptor, which can bind to and transform into an active form upon contact with specific dioxin-like compounds such as polychlorinated dibenzodioxins and polychlorinated biphenyls. The process optimizes detection of the transformed Ah receptor's complex with ARNT, enabling more effective assessment of environmental hazards.
Career Highlights
Wheelock has built a notable career working with various organizations. He has contributed his expertise at Paracelsian, Inc. and Cornell Research Foundation Inc., where his innovative ideas have paved the way for advancements in medical and environmental research.
Collaborations
Throughout his career, Wheelock has collaborated with esteemed colleagues, including John G. Babish and Joseph Rininger. These partnerships have facilitated the exchange of ideas and enhanced the development of innovative solutions in their respective fields.
